Тротуар как место битвы робота и человека

В контексте роботизации городов обычно обсуждают энергоэффективность, полностью беспилотное движение и автономные сады. Но в реальном мире проблемы всплывают совсем в других плоскостях.Роботы-доставщики уже стали привычной частью городского пейзажа. В Лос-Анджелесе по улицам одновременно ездят сотни автономных курьеров компаний Serve Robotics и Coco Robotics. Альбер Робида: человек, нарисовавший стимпанк и предсказавший киберпанк в XIX веке. Часть 2

В прошлой части мы разобрали первые два произведения цикла «Двадцатый век»: роман с описанием жизни Парижа будущего и графическую новеллу о военном деле. Уже в них обнаруживается немало метких предсказаний, очень неочевидных для 1880-х годов, — к примеру, штурмовка с воздуха колонны бронетехники, думскроллинг мрачных новостей по телефону или рост популярности видеороликов длиной в несколько минут.
